Who We Support
This provision is specifically designed for children and young people with SEND and highly complex behavioural, regulation and social / emotional needs. Due to the intensive nature of the support provided, and in order to ensure the safety, wellbeing and engagement of all participants and staff, the following entrance criteria must be met:

SEND and Highly Complex Behavioural, Regulation and Social / Emotional Needs
The child or young person must present with significant and persistent behavioural and/or emotional regulation needs that cannot be safely or effectively supported in universal or targeted group settings.

High Staff Support Ratio Required
The child or young person must require a minimum staffing ratio of 2:1 to access any group-based provision safely. This includes needs related to emotional regulation, physical safety (of self and others), and engagement.

Specialist Trained Staff Only
All staff within the provision are trained to NAPPI UK standards (Non-Abusive Psychological and Physical Intervention). Children or young people referred to the setting must require staff trained in this specialist approach due to the level of physical intervention or proactive support they may require.

Professional Referral and Risk Assessment
Access to the provision must be via a professional referral (e.g. social worker, local authority, or health professional) and must include a current risk assessment and behaviour support plan that confirms the need for this level of support.
